Tour de France and the tree
2011-07-02
The world’s greatest sporting spectacle starts today – Le Tour de France. Sit back and watch the beauty of France’s trees and forests.Continue Reading
The world’s greatest sporting spectacle starts today – Le Tour de France. Sit back and watch the beauty of France’s trees and forests.Continue Reading
Copyright © Gabriel Hemery 2010-2023.
Creative Commons License. This work is licensed under a Creative Commons Attribution- NonCommercial- NoDerivs 3.0 United States License.
Affiliate Link Disclosure
Privacy Policy